Using the headset

Use the headset to make or answer calls
without holding the phone.
Connect the headset to the jack on the left
side of the phone. The button on the
headset works as follows:
To
Press
redial the last call
the button twice.
answer a call
the button.
end a call
the button.

Adjusting the volume during a call

Use [Volume] to adjust the earpiece volume
during a call.
Press [Volume up] to increase the volume
level and [Volume down] to decrease the
volume level.
